Output bc602394685b940dbe13ded6a4403aae59a97b891e18bde86eca000242d2d54b:0

value
66447269
script pubkey
OP_0 OP_PUSHBYTES_20 f6808251f913bb3fb4dba9a10f961b383379c3e8
address
bc1q76qgy50ezwanldxm4xssl9sm8qehnslglx3fh3
transaction
bc602394685b940dbe13ded6a4403aae59a97b891e18bde86eca000242d2d54b
confirmations
124683
spent
true